I need to transform a forEach in promise. The code is legacy and I can't use async/await operators.

Promise.all(Object.entries(data).forEach(function (data) {
        let [data1, data2] = data
        let info;

        consultData.getResponse(data1).then(result => info = result).then(function () {
            return dataServices.find(info)
                .then(function (result) {
                    // do things
                })
                .then(function (info) {
                    // do final things
                })
        })
    })).then((result) => {
            // do something when all things have intereted and finished
        })

But output that Promise.all can't be used. If I try with Promise.resolve, the last is printed before all things have finished their processing.

How I can transform the forEach in a promise for i can use .then() after all iteration?

ASYNC/AWAIT DON'T WORK IN THIS CODE
